How much do masters in finance j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for masters in finance in Florida is $69,223.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$56,000.00 and $81,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Masters in Finance?

A Masters in Finance is a specialized graduate degree that focuses on financial theory, quantitative finance, financial markets, and investment analysis. The program is designed to equip students with advanced skills in areas such as corporate finance, risk management, asset pricing, and financial modeling. Graduates are prepared for careers in investment banking, asset management, corporate finance, or financial consulting. The degree typically takes one to two years to complete and is suitable for those looking to deepen their expertise in finance or pivot into the financial sector.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ive with a Masters in Finance?

To thrive with a Master's in Finance, you need advanced knowledge of financial analysis, quantitative modeling, and economic theory, typically acquired through graduate-level coursework. Familiarity with financial software such as Bloomberg, Excel, and statistical tools, as well as certifications like CFA or FRM, is highly valued.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help professionals interpret data and present insights clearly. These abilities are crucial for making informed financial decisions, managing risk, and adding value in competitive finance roles.

What career paths can a graduate with a Masters in Finance pursue?

A Masters in Finance opens doors to a range of specialized roles, including investment banking, asset management, corporate finance, risk management, and financial consulting. Graduates often start in analyst or associate positions and can progress to senior roles like portfolio manager, finance director, or chief financial officer over time. Networking, professional certifications, and hands-on internships during your studies can significantly enhance your advancement opportunities. The finance industry values a blend of analytical skills, strong communication, and the ability to work collaboratively in fast-paced, team-oriented environments.

How useful is a master's in finance?

A master's in finance provides advanced knowledge of financial analysis, investment strategies, and quantitative skills, which can enhance job prospects in roles such as financial analyst, investment banker, or risk manager. It often leads to higher earning potential and may be required for specialized positions or certifications like CFA. The degree also helps develop skills in financial modeling and data analysis using tools like Excel and financial software.

What jobs can you get with a Masters in Finance?

A Masters in Finance prepares individuals for roles such as financial analyst, investment banker, risk manager, portfolio manager, and financial advisor. These positions typically require strong analytical skills, knowledge of financial modeling, and proficiency with tools like Excel and financial software. Many roles also require relevant certifications such as CFA or CPA.
